summaryrefslogtreecommitdiffstats
path: root/winsup/cygwin/ChangeLog
diff options
context:
space:
mode:
Diffstat (limited to 'winsup/cygwin/ChangeLog')
-rw-r--r--winsup/cygwin/ChangeLog25
1 files changed, 25 insertions, 0 deletions
diff --git a/winsup/cygwin/ChangeLog b/winsup/cygwin/ChangeLog
index 16a2307d5..90bbd2144 100644
--- a/winsup/cygwin/ChangeLog
+++ b/winsup/cygwin/ChangeLog
@@ -1,3 +1,28 @@
+2005-06-06 Corinna Vinschen <corinna@vinschen.de>
+
+ * pinfo.cc (pinfo::init): Define sa_buf as PSECURITY_ATTRIBUTES and
+ allocate dynamically.
+ (pinfo::set_acl): Replace sa_buf by dynamically allocated acl_buf.
+ * sec_acl.cc (setacl): Allocate acl dynamically.
+ * sec_helper.cc (sec_acl): Add test for alignment of acl when
+ DEBUGGING is defined.
+ (__sec_user): Same for sa_buf.
+ * security.cc (verify_token): Define sd_buf as PSECURITY_DESCRIPTOR
+ and allocate dynamically.
+ (alloc_sd): Allocate acl dynamically.
+ security.h (sec_user_nih): Change first parameter to
+ SECURITY_ATTRIBUTES *.
+ (sec_user): Ditto.
+ * sigproc.cc (wait_sig): Define sa_buf as PSECURITY_ATTRIBUTES and
+ allocate dynamically.
+ * syscalls.cc (seteuid32): Define dacl_buf as PACL and allocate
+ dynamically.
+ * uinfo.cc (cygheap_user::init): Define sa_buf as PSECURITY_ATTRIBUTES
+ and allocate dynamically.
+ * winbase.h (ilockincr): Mark first argument of inline assembly as
+ earlyclobber.
+ (ilockdecr): Ditto.
+
2005-06-07 Christopher Faylor <cgf@timesys.com>
* cygthread.cc (cygthread::detach): Make error message a little more